Quality Assessment

As of 17 June 2026, Pioneer Embroideries Ltd exhibits a below-average quality grade. The company’s long-term fundamental strength remains weak, with a concerning comp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of operating profits at -157.75% over the past five years. This steep decline highlights persistent operational challenges and an inability to generate consistent earnings growth.

Profitability metrics further underscore this weakness. The average return on equity (ROE) stands at a modest 3.18%, reflecting limited efficiency in generating profits from shareholders’ funds. Additionally, the company’s ability to service debt is strained, with a high Debt to EBITDA ratio of 6.71 times, indicating elevated leverage and financial risk.

Valuation Considerations

The valuation grade for Pioneer Embroideries Ltd is currently classified as risky. The company has recorded negative operating profits, with an EBIT of Rs. -1.19 crore as per the latest data. This negative earnings performance contributes to the stock’s unfavourable valuation metrics, making it less attractive relative to its historical averages and sector peers.

Investors should note that the stock’s price-to-earnings and other valuation multiples reflect this risk, suggesting that the market is pricing in continued operational difficulties. The high proportion of promoter shares pledged—52.59%—adds further pressure, as it may lead to forced selling in declining markets, exacerbating downward price movements.

Financial Trend and Returns

Examining the financial trend as of 17 June 2026, the company’s performance remains underwhelming. Over the past year, Pioneer Embroideries Ltd has delivered a negative return of -39.60%, significantly underperforming the BSE500 benchmark and the broader Garments & Apparels sector. This consistent underperformance has persisted over the last three annual periods, signalling structural challenges in the business model or market positioning.

Profitability has deteriorated sharply, with profits falling by -160.8% in the last year. The negative operating profit trend and weak cash flow generation raise concerns about the company’s ability to sustain operations without additional capital or restructuring.

Technical Outlook

The technical grade for Pioneer Embroideries Ltd is mildly bearish. Recent price movements show mixed signals, with a slight decline of -0.08% on the latest trading day, but some short-term gains such as a 9.58% increase over the past week and a 10.79% rise over three months. Despite these intermittent rallies, the six-month and year-to-date returns remain negative at -7.25% and -8.01% respectively, reinforcing the cautious technical stance.

Overall, the technical indicators suggest limited momentum and potential resistance levels that may hinder sustained upward movement in the near term.
